Apr 25, 2017 A piece of green wood is weighed, then dried, then weighed again. Suppose the wood weighed 40 pounds when green and only 30 pounds after drying. The 10 pounds of water lost represents one-third of its oven-dry weight, so the wood would have had a 33 1 ⁄ 3 percent moisture content. Aug 05, 2019 2. Split the wood. Wood that is split along the grain will dry up to 15 times faster than wood that is surrounded in bark. The more split surfaces, the faster the wood will dry. Unsplit wood can actually stay green and wet even in perfect drying conditions for a whole Summer! Try to split wood in to smaller pieces.

by Eric Meier Allowing lumber to passively sit at a given humidity level in order to obtain a desired EMC (air-drying) may be the simplest and least expensive method of seasoning wood, but it is also the very slowest. Drying times can vary significantly depending upon wood species, initial moisture level, lumber thickness, density, ambient conditions, and processing techniques.

Longitudinal shrinkage of wood (shrinkage parallel to the grain) is quite small. The longitudinal shrinkage from green to oven-dry condition is only 0.1 to 0.2 percent for most species of wood...so small, that it can usually be ignored. Shrinkage Values Of Domestic Hardwoods. One pound of oven-dry wood of any hardwood species has an available heat value of about 8,600 Btu. Resinous softwood species, such as shortleaf pine, tend to average slightly higher at 9,050 Btu per oven-dry pound. Freshly cut Missouri hardwoods commonly have a 75 percent moisture content on an oven-dry basis.
